Comunidad de diseño web y desarrollo en internet online

Como linquear una imagen con el componente photoflow

Ir a página Anterior  1, 2

Foros de discusión > Flash

Citar            
MensajeEscrito el 06 Dic 2008 02:22 pm
Perdón, lo he cambiado por loadMovie("link",movieClip)...y nada. :?

Por natig

76 de clabLevel



 

msie7
Citar            
MensajeEscrito el 08 Dic 2008 04:51 pm
Hola de nuevo!

He subido un archivo rar con todo lo que he hecho, para q lo veáis y podáis ayudarme: http://d01.megashares.com/?d01=670efac

Espero q lo podáis descargar fácilmente, y muchas gracias de antemano.

Un beso!

Por natig

76 de clabLevel



 

msie7
Citar            
MensajeEscrito el 26 Ene 2009 05:35 pm
:shock: Hola a todos, necesito lo mismo que naty, tengo el archivo xml correcto , le doy la accion al frame del photoflow y no me resulta. Naty si te respondieron, y te resulto, por favor. me puedes enviar el codigo.

Muchisimas gracias!!-----lo necesito hacer urgente...
Un abrazo a todos.-

Por PenelopeGlamour

1 de clabLevel



 

msie
Citar            
MensajeEscrito el 05 Mar 2009 04:25 pm
PUFFF, ya estamos en marzo y ni una respuesta al problema, se ve q nadie lo sabe...he preguntado en otro foro y tampoco, habrá q resignarse...

Por natig

76 de clabLevel



 

msie7
Citar            
MensajeEscrito el 18 Mar 2009 01:07 am
Y como se supone que veo la documentacion del componente?

Estoy en las mismas... tratando de linkear las imagenes ke carga el photosflow...

Primero que todo lo descargue y viene con vaaarios archivos...

AC_RunActiveContent
demo.fla
photoFlow.apf
photoFlow (Flash Component File) ...que supongo que ahi viene la documentacion o no???
photoFlowScrollBar (Flash Component File)
photoFlow AS3.fla
photoFlowScrollBar AS3.fla

y con varias carpetas, demo, backup, classes, PhotoFlow AS3, live preview...

Disculpen la ignorancia... pero no se donde ver la documentacion...

Ademas, si pongo el codigo: (en el fotograma donde va photofhlow, cuando lo veo pestañea en el 100% y no carga las imagenes)

var listener:Object = new Object();

listener.onSelectPhoto = function(evt){

var link:String = evt.link;
getURL(link, "_blank");

}
myPhotos.addEventListener("onSelectPhoto", listener);






Que alguien me ayude por favor!!! T_______T

Por Matt Giuria

0 de clabLevel



 

msie7
Citar            
MensajeEscrito el 10 Dic 2009 02:04 pm
Hola estuve revisando los ejemplos q dan para cargar la URL en el photo flow... hay alguna para q me abra el link pero yo sea la q le de click no q me abra automaticamente???

Por masninos

3 de clabLevel



 

firefox
Citar            
MensajeEscrito el 11 Dic 2009 11:18 pm
@masninos, los ejemploas están realizados para que el link abra cuando des click en la imagen. Si no te sucede los mismo postea la porción de código respectivo a la carga del link a ver si hay algún problema.

Por elchininet

Claber

3921 de clabLevel

17 tutoriales

Genero:Masculino  

Front-end developer at Booking.com

firefox
Citar            
MensajeEscrito el 08 Jun 2010 05:27 pm

elchininet escribió:

Debes añadir otro atributo a tu XML:

Código XML :

<?xml version="1.0" encoding="utf-8"?>
<photos path="images/">
   <photo name="Photo 1" url="1.jpg" link="http://www.google.com">This is the optional description for photo 1</photo>
   <photo name="Photo 2" url="2.jpg" link="http://www.yahoo.com">This is the optional description for photo 2</photo>
   <photo name="Photo 3" url="3.jpg" link="http://www.hotmail.com">This is the optional description for photo 3</photo>
   <photo name="Photo 4" url="4.jpg" link="http://www.microsoft.com">This is the optional description for photo 4</photo>
   <photo name="Photo 5" url="5.jpg" link="http://www.cristalab.com">This is the optional description for photo 5</photo>
</photos>


Después suponiendo que tu componente tiene un nombre de instancia de "myPhotos" debes poner esto en el frame donde se encuentra este:

Código ActionScript :

var listener:Object = new Object();

listener.onSelectPhoto = function(evt){    
   
   var link:String = evt.link;
   getURL(link, "_blank");    
    
} 
myPhotos.addEventListener("onSelectPhoto", listener); 


Hola he leído el caso y es muy similar a la cuestión que tengo, he realizado lo mismo, solo que al momento que corre la película de flash en el frame donde se encuentra el photoflow me habré inmediatamente el explorador mostrando todas las web que se programaron de forma simultánea sin que haya dado un solo click sobre alguna de las imagenes de mi photoflow, me podrían indicar que hice mal. Gracias.

Por condoro

2 de clabLevel



 

safari
Citar            
MensajeEscrito el 08 Jun 2010 05:33 pm

elchininet escribió:

Debes añadir otro atributo a tu XML:

Código XML :

<?xml version="1.0" encoding="utf-8"?>
<photos path="images/">
   <photo name="Photo 1" url="1.jpg" link="http://www.google.com">This is the optional description for photo 1</photo>
   <photo name="Photo 2" url="2.jpg" link="http://www.yahoo.com">This is the optional description for photo 2</photo>
   <photo name="Photo 3" url="3.jpg" link="http://www.hotmail.com">This is the optional description for photo 3</photo>
   <photo name="Photo 4" url="4.jpg" link="http://www.microsoft.com">This is the optional description for photo 4</photo>
   <photo name="Photo 5" url="5.jpg" link="http://www.cristalab.com">This is the optional description for photo 5</photo>
</photos>


Después suponiendo que tu componente tiene un nombre de instancia de "myPhotos" debes poner esto en el frame donde se encuentra este:

Código ActionScript :

var listener:Object = new Object();

listener.onSelectPhoto = function(evt){    
   
   var link:String = evt.link;
   getURL(link, "_blank");    
    
} 
myPhotos.addEventListener("onSelectPhoto", listener); 


Hola he leído el caso y es muy similar a la cuestión que tengo, he realizado lo mismo, solo que al momento que corre la película de flash en el frame donde se encuentra el photoflow me habré inmediatamente el explorador mostrando todas las web que se programaron de forma simultánea sin que haya dado un solo click sobre alguna de las imagenes de mi photoflow, me podrían indicar que hice mal. Gracias.

Por condoro

2 de clabLevel



 

safari
Citar            
MensajeEscrito el 08 Jun 2010 07:49 pm
condoro, postea el código que estás utilizando, así alguien podrá detectar dónde está el problema.

Por elchininet

Claber

3921 de clabLevel

17 tutoriales

Genero:Masculino  

Front-end developer at Booking.com

firefox
Citar            
MensajeEscrito el 10 Jun 2010 04:21 pm
Hola Gracias por atender mi llamado, les publico lo que estoy haciendo:

XML

<?xml version="1.0" encoding="utf-8"?>
<photos path="productos/">
<photo name="Photo 1" url="1.jpg" link="http://www.google.com">This is the optional description for photo 1</photo>
<photo name="Photo 2" url="2.jpg" link="http://www.yahoo.com">This is the optional description for photo 2</photo>
<photo name="Photo 3" url="3.jpg" link="http://www.hotmail.com">This is the optional description for photo 3</photo>
<photo name="Photo 4" url="4.jpg" link="http://www.microsoft.com">This is the optional description for photo 4</photo>
<photo name="Photo 5" url="5.jpg" link="http://www.cristalab.com">This is the optional description for photo 5</photo>
</photos>

En el frame donde esta el photoflow, exactamente en el mismo:

var listener:Object = new Object();
listener.onSelectPhoto = function(evt){
var link:String = evt.link;
getURL(link, "_blank");
}
myPhotos.addEventListener("onSelectPhoto", listener);

Espero sus comentarios. Gracias

Por condoro

2 de clabLevel



 

safari
Citar            
MensajeEscrito el 10 Jun 2010 05:39 pm

condoro escribió:

Hola Gracias por atender mi llamado, les publico lo que estoy haciendo:

XML

<?xml version="1.0" encoding="utf-8"?>
<photos path="productos/">
<photo name="Photo 1" url="1.jpg" link="http://www.google.com">This is the optional description for photo 1</photo>
<photo name="Photo 2" url="2.jpg" link="http://www.yahoo.com">This is the optional description for photo 2</photo>
<photo name="Photo 3" url="3.jpg" link="http://www.hotmail.com">This is the optional description for photo 3</photo>
<photo name="Photo 4" url="4.jpg" link="http://www.microsoft.com">This is the optional description for photo 4</photo>
<photo name="Photo 5" url="5.jpg" link="http://www.cristalab.com">This is the optional description for photo 5</photo>
</photos>

En el frame donde esta el photoflow, exactamente en el mismo:

var listener:Object = new Object();
listener.onSelectPhoto = function(evt){
var link:String = evt.link;
getURL(link, "_blank");
}
myPhotos.addEventListener("onSelectPhoto", listener);

Espero sus comentarios. Gracias


He cambiado el onSelectPhoto por onDoubleClick lo cual me ha dado como resultado que las ligas a sitios web no se habrán automaticamente, solo que al abrir el explorador me da la ruta final como indefined, lo cual no se ha que se refiere.

Por condoro

2 de clabLevel



 

safari
Citar            
MensajeEscrito el 24 Jun 2010 08:12 am
@condoro, disculpa la demora en responder. Por lo que veo tu código está correcto así que el problema debe estar en otro sitio. Con "onSelectPhoto" te debería funcionar sin problemas, no hace falta que lo cambies a "onDoubleClick". ¿Lo has probado en otros navegadores aparte de safari? ¿Has leído la documentación respecto a este evento a ver si dice algo de lo que te sucede?

Por elchininet

Claber

3921 de clabLevel

17 tutoriales

Genero:Masculino  

Front-end developer at Booking.com

firefox
Ir a página Anterior  1, 2
Foros de discusión > Flash

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.